The case study titled “A Patient Information System for Mental Health Care” discusses the implementation of a patient information system in a mental health care organization. The purpose of the system is to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of patient care by providing real-time access to patient information to the clinical staff.

The case study highlights the challenges faced by the organization in implementing the system, such as resistance from the clinical staff and lack of training and support. It also discusses the benefits of the system, such as improved care coordination, reduced medication errors, and enhanced decision-making.

One of the key features of the patient information system is the electronic health record (EHR), which allows for the digital storage and retrieval of patient information. The EHR includes data such as patient demographics, medical history, medications, and treatment plans. It also integrates with other systems, such as the pharmacy and laboratory systems, to provide a comprehensive view of the patient’s care.

The case study also emphasizes the importance of data security and privacy in the implementation of the system. Measures such as user authentication, data encryption, and access controls are implemented to ensure the confidentiality and integrity of patient information.

In addition to the technical aspects, the case study addresses the importance of change management in the successful implementation of the system. The organization faced resistance from the clinical staff, who were initially skeptical about the benefits of the system and concerned about the additional workload. To address these concerns, the organization provided training and support to the staff, as well as clear communication about the goals and benefits of the system.

Overall, the case study highlights the importance of a well-planned and well-executed implementation process for a patient information system in a mental health care organization. It demonstrates the potential benefits of such a system in improving patient care, as well as the challenges and considerations that need to be addressed.
